Transforming lives. One student at time” (Blueprint, 2010); isn’t just as saying at Education Corporation of America but is in fact a way of life. ECA is a collection of six higher educational institutions that provide life altering experiences to students. ECA has been around since nineteen eighty-three, and with its many locations across the US is able to provide masters, associates, and bachelor degrees as well as certificate and diploma courses (Schools, 2013). The number one goal of ECA and all six of its schools is to build scalable career platforms that will be recognized for its high quality programs, predictable results, and superior operating systems (Blueprint, 2010). Each institution is able to put students and all their needs first and each has a management that creates routines that avoids surprises and seeks solutions verses excuses when problems do arise. All of this is done which allows us to have one team that shares a common goal of transforming lives through education (Blueprint, 2010). The six institutions that all share these principles and one common goal are as follows, Virginia College (26 locations), Virginia College Online, Culinard The Culinary Institute of Virginia College, Golf Academy of America, Ecotech Institute, and lastly the New England College of Business and Finance (Schools, 2013).
